[TechAssist] Re: Ct-36G23W large bow on each side

Hello Everyone
                        Thought I would give you an updated fix on this dog.
After replacing the H.O.Transistor and regulator with original, I decided to
look closer at the stand-up board for pincushion, and I discovered
C757=220uF 35 volt and C756uF 16 volt capacitors were almost completely
open, replaced them and bow in picture disappeared but I could not get the
width to fill the entire picture as this is adjusted from R760 a 5k pot
which I had to turn all the way in one direction to almost get the picture
at full width, I went over that board many many times until I finally found
that the width control R760 which should read 5k was reading about 2k,
replaced pot and now picture fills the screen.

>   Hello Everyone,
>                         This 36" Panasonic came in dead with shorted Q551
HOT =2sd2539, replaced it with a 2sd1881 from Tritronics (I know I should
use the OEM) but not in stock, and I am trying to verify if the set has any
other problems.
> My question is are there any other common problems with this chassis
(AEDP313) concerning pincushion, that could be causing my problem, or do I
have the bowing on each side because I am not using the original HOT. B+ is
running at 130 volts, I replaced C820 and resoldered all bad joints. I do
not have schematic. If anyone has this schematic and could upload it, that
would help to check other voltages. This chassis has a stand-up board for
pincushion and everything seems ok on that board too. I did not replace the
regulator (IC803=STR58041) as it seems to be working. Any suggestions?
